Overview
Install a heat pump system that provides both heating and cooling from a single unit. Heat pumps are highly efficient, using electricity to transfer heat rather than generate it, reducing energy costs by 30-50%.

Heat Pump Installation in Alhambra
As a homeowner in Alhambra, you're no stranger to hot summers and mild winters. With the city's Mediterranean climate, temperatures can soar during the summer months, while cooler breezes roll in from January to March. Installing a heat pump system is an excellent way to stay comfortable and reduce your energy bills. A single unit that provides both heating and cooling can be especially beneficial in Alhambra, where homes are often built with older systems and may not have modern HVAC capabilities.
When choosing a heat pump installation in Alhambra, it's essential to consider the system type, home square footage, and number of zones. For example, a larger home with multiple zones would require a more complex system that can handle the increased demand. The existing ductwork condition also plays a significant role, as damaged or inefficient ducts can negate the benefits of a heat pump installation. According to data, homes in Alhambra were built on average in 1960, which means many have outdated HVAC systems that are no longer energy-efficient.
The cost range for a heat pump installation in Alhambra is between $4,000 and $12,000, depending on the factors mentioned above. To give you a better idea, air-source heat pumps typically fall within the lower to mid-range of this price spectrum, while ground-source systems tend to be more expensive due to their added complexity. Regardless of which system type you choose, a well-installed heat pump can help reduce your energy bills by 30-50% and provide years of reliable comfort in Alhambra's unique climate.

California Regulations
Building Code: CBC 2022 (based on IRC 2021)
Seller Disclosure: California has among the most extensive disclosure requirements in the US. Sellers must complete a Transfer Disclosure Statement (TDS) plus Natural Hazard Disclosure (NHD).
Natural Disaster Risks: Earthquakes, Wildfires, Mudslides, Drought
